客户机和服务器模式有什么特点,客户机和服务器的概念
- 综合资讯
- 2024-09-28 18:43:52
- 5

客户机和服务器是网络通信中的两种重要角色。客户机通常是指请求服务的一方,它向服务器发送请求并接收响应。客户机具有以下特点:用户界面友好,易于使用;可以在不同的操作系统上...
客户机和服务器模式是一种常见的网络计算模式。客户机通常是指请求服务的一方,它通过网络向服务器发送请求,并接收服务器返回的结果。服务器则是提供服务的一方,它接收客户机的请求,并根据请求执行相应的操作,然后将结果返回给客户机。,,客户机和服务器模式的特点包括:,1. 分工明确:客户机和服务器分别承担不同的任务,提高了系统的效率和可靠性。,2. 易于扩展:可以通过增加服务器的数量来提高系统的处理能力,满足不断增长的业务需求。,3. 安全性高:服务器可以对客户机的请求进行验证和授权,保证系统的安全性。,4. 灵活性强:客户机和服务器可以采用不同的技术和协议,满足不同的业务需求。,,客户机和服务器模式是一种高效、可靠、安全、灵活的网络计算模式,被广泛应用于各种网络应用系统中。
标题:客户机/服务器模式:网络通信的基石
一、引言
在当今数字化的时代,计算机网络已经成为人们生活和工作中不可或缺的一部分,而客户机/服务器(Client/Server,C/S)模式作为一种常见的网络通信架构,在各种应用场景中发挥着重要作用,本文将深入探讨客户机和服务器模式的特点,以及它们在网络通信中的重要性。
二、客户机和服务器的定义
客户机是指请求服务的一方,它通常是一个用户终端,如个人电脑、智能手机或平板电脑等,客户机通过网络与服务器进行通信,并向服务器发送请求,服务器则是提供服务的一方,它可以是一台高性能的计算机或一组计算机,负责处理客户机的请求,并返回相应的结果。
三、客户机/服务器模式的特点
1、分工明确:客户机和服务器在功能上有明确的分工,客户机主要负责用户界面的展示和用户交互,而服务器则负责数据的存储、处理和管理,这种分工使得系统的设计和维护更加简单,提高了系统的可靠性和稳定性。
2、高性能:服务器通常具有强大的计算能力和存储能力,可以处理大量的并发请求,通过将数据存储在服务器上,客户机可以快速地访问和共享数据,提高了系统的性能和响应速度。
3、安全性高:服务器通常位于企业内部或数据中心,受到严格的安全保护,客户机通过网络与服务器进行通信,服务器可以对客户机的请求进行身份验证和授权,确保只有合法的用户可以访问和使用系统资源。
4、可扩展性强:客户机/服务器模式可以很容易地进行扩展,当系统的负载增加时,可以通过增加服务器的数量来提高系统的性能和处理能力,服务器还可以支持分布式计算和集群技术,进一步提高系统的可扩展性。
5、易于维护和管理:客户机/服务器模式的系统结构相对简单,易于维护和管理,服务器可以集中管理系统的资源和配置,客户机可以通过网络进行远程管理和监控,大大降低了系统的维护成本和管理难度。
四、客户机/服务器模式的应用场景
1、企业资源规划(ERP):ERP 系统是一种用于企业管理的综合性软件,它通常采用客户机/服务器模式,客户机用于员工的日常操作,如订单录入、库存管理等,服务器则用于存储和管理企业的核心数据。
2、数据库管理系统(DBMS):DBMS 是用于管理数据库的软件,它也通常采用客户机/服务器模式,客户机用于用户与数据库的交互,如查询、插入、更新等,服务器则负责数据库的存储、查询和优化。
3、电子邮件系统:电子邮件系统是一种用于发送和接收电子邮件的软件,它也可以采用客户机/服务器模式,客户机用于用户撰写和发送电子邮件,服务器则负责邮件的存储、转发和分发。
4、网络游戏:网络游戏是一种通过网络进行多人交互的游戏,它通常采用客户机/服务器模式,客户机用于玩家的游戏操作,如移动、攻击等,服务器则负责游戏的逻辑处理、数据同步和玩家管理。
五、结论
客户机/服务器模式是一种广泛应用于网络通信的架构,它具有分工明确、高性能、安全性高、可扩展性强和易于维护管理等特点,在当今数字化的时代,客户机/服务器模式将继续发挥重要作用,为人们的生活和工作带来更多的便利和效率。
本文链接:https://www.zhitaoyun.cn/4325.html
发表评论